More about Erin Baker
Erin has been a motoring journalist since 2003. She was the Motoring Editor at the Telegraph Media Group for four years, during which time she got her race licence and bike licence. She then had kids, which effectively meant she kissed goodbye to driving any sexy two-seater sports cars.
In 2014 she became Managing Director of Motoring at the Telegraph, a hybrid role that brought together various editorial and commercial aspects. She then left the Telegraph in 2016 to pursue a freelance career, primarily as a motorsport marketing consultant at the Goodwood estate. She also became Automotive Editor of Robb Report UK, and the Editor of Dream, Honda's customer magazine.
In 2017, Erin was appointed as Editorial Director at Auto Trader. She is a strong advocate of content which de-mystifies the car world, by replacing insider jargon with plain English. She believes in a gender-neutral car industry, and has found her spiritual home at Auto Trader.
In 2022 Erin won Consumer Journalist of the Year in the Newspress Awards.
